On Wed, 23 Apr 2025 15:28:07 +0200 Thorsten Leemhuis wrote:
> Does anyone know why this problem occurs? 

I typo'ed the inclusion guard :( Will send this shortly:

diff --git a/tools/net/ynl/Makefile.deps b/tools/net/ynl/Makefile.deps
index 8b7bf673b686..a5e6093903fb 100644
--- a/tools/net/ynl/Makefile.deps
+++ b/tools/net/ynl/Makefile.deps
@@ -27,7 +27,7 @@ CFLAGS_netdev:=$(call get_hdr_inc,_LINUX_NETDEV_H,netdev.h)
 CFLAGS_nl80211:=$(call get_hdr_inc,__LINUX_NL802121_H,nl80211.h)
 CFLAGS_nlctrl:=$(call get_hdr_inc,__LINUX_GENERIC_NETLINK_H,genetlink.h)
 CFLAGS_nfsd:=$(call get_hdr_inc,_LINUX_NFSD_NETLINK_H,nfsd_netlink.h)
-CFLAGS_ovpn:=$(call get_hdr_inc,_LINUX_OVPN,ovpn.h)
+CFLAGS_ovpn:=$(call get_hdr_inc,_LINUX_OVPN_H,ovpn.h)
 CFLAGS_ovs_datapath:=$(call get_hdr_inc,__LINUX_OPENVSWITCH_H,openvswitch.h)
 CFLAGS_ovs_flow:=$(call get_hdr_inc,__LINUX_OPENVSWITCH_H,openvswitch.h)
